What Is an Online Air Particle Counter?
An Online Air Particle Counter is a sophisticated monitoring instrument designed to continuously measure and record airborne particle concentrations in controlled environments.
Unlike portable particle counters that perform periodic inspections, online systems operate continuously and provide real-time data regarding air cleanliness levels.
These instruments detect particles of various sizes and generate accurate measurements that help maintain cleanroom classifications and contamination control programs.
In pharmaceutical facilities, online air particle counters are commonly integrated into environmental monitoring systems for continuous oversight of critical manufacturing areas.

Key Features of High-Performance Online Air Particle Counters
Modern online particle counting systems offer advanced capabilities designed specifically for pharmaceutical cleanrooms.
Multi-Channel Particle Detection
These systems can detect and classify particles across multiple size ranges simultaneously.
Real-Time Data Collection
Instant measurement and reporting provide immediate visibility into cleanroom conditions.
Alarm and Notification Functions
Automated alarms notify personnel when particle levels exceed predefined limits.
Data Logging and Reporting
Comprehensive data storage supports audits, investigations, and trend analysis.
Network Integration
Many systems integrate with Building Management Systems (BMS) and Environmental Monitoring Systems (EMS).
Remote Monitoring
Users can access monitoring data from centralized control stations or network-connected devices.

Choosing the Best Online Air Particle Counter Solution
Selecting the right monitoring system requires careful evaluation of facility requirements.
Monitoring Requirements
Determine the number of locations that require continuous monitoring and the cleanroom classifications involved.
Particle Size Detection Range
Ensure the instrument can detect the particle sizes relevant to your compliance requirements.
Regulatory Compliance Support
Choose systems that support GMP, ISO 14644, and other pharmaceutical regulations.
Data Management Capabilities
Evaluate data storage, reporting, and integration features.
Scalability
Consider future expansion needs and select a system that can accommodate additional monitoring points.
Technical Support and Service
Reliable technical support ensures long-term system performance and compliance.
